1930: Joe Glazer: Songs of Steel and Struggle

Folklife and Cultural Heritage

Object Details

Collection Musician

Penn, Larry
McGee, Bobbie

Collection Creator

Collector Records

Collection Musician

Magpie
Killen, Louis

Collection Creator

Glazer, Joe, 1918-2006

Collection Citation

Collector Records business records, Ralph Rinzler Folklife Archives and Collections, Smithsonian Institution.

Scope and Contents note

Pittsburgh--Red iron ore--The ballad of John Catchins--United steelworkers are we--Amalgamate as one--The Homestead Strike--Memorial Day Massacre--The spirit of Phil Murray--Too old to work--Corrido del Minero--Steel mill blues--1913 massacre--I lie in the American land--When a fellow is out of a job--Solidarity forever.
